Donating Through Planned Giving

Several different options of "Planned Giving" are available.

Contributions Through Your Will

Preparing a will is sometimes an emotional and thought-provoking endeavor. Whether you have accumulated vast assets or have only a few possessions, a will prevents legal complications and delays.  It directs your personal representative to deal with your estate as you wish.

Another important aspect of a will is that it allows you to have an impact on the lives of others
even after your death.  Your will can continue a legacy of caring and making a difference.

If you decide to support Harvest Time Ministries, Inc. through your will, you can specify a particular amount of money or an asset such as stock or property.  Consider giving the remainder or a portion of the remainder of your estate after expenses and gifts to your loved ones have been paid out.

The interest in real estate or a trust designated initially for the lifetime benefit of a loved one could be specified for a gift.  Sometimes individuals prefer making a contingent gift that takes effect only under certain circumstances (for example, "If my spouse does not survive me,").

What if you already have a will?  Often you can add a bequest to Harvest Time Ministries, Inc. to your existing will simply by consulting your attorney about an amendment known as a "codicil."  When you have completed your will or added a provision for Harvest Time Ministries to your current will, we hope you’ll let us know so we can express our thanks!

Giving through a Living Trust
If you would like to create an estate plan that allows some privacy and has additional features, a living trust may be something you wish to discuss with your attorney.  A gift to the Harvest Time Ministries from such a trust can be arranged upon your death, just as with a will.
